Dr. Sameh Kamel, MBBS
Organizing Partner for External Affairs and International Relations Arab Youth Platform for Sustainable Development – League of Arab States
Sameh Kamel graduated in August 2020 from October 6 University with an MBBS (Bachelor of Medicine, Bachelor of Surgery) with honours.
Dr. Kamel is a strong youth activist. Since 2015, Sameh has been the Regional Focal Point of the Middle East and North Africa at the United Nations Major Group for Children and Youth (UNMGCY). Through his role, he facilitated youth engagement at multiple United Nations intergovernmental negotiations and processes on behalf of UNMGCY. Processes such as the High Level Political Forum, Habitat III, World Humanitarian Summit, Global Compact on Migration and the UN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D). During the processes, Sameh hosted multiple open-ended consultations on youth priorities on topics related to the process at hand to further build the UNMGCY position papers.
Furthermore, Dr. Kamel held a number of training sessions on Sustainable Development and Youth Advocacy in countries like Zambia, Zimbabwe, Ghana, Kenya, Indonesia, Lebanon, UAE, Morocco, Tunisia, Mexico, Italy, , USA, Canada and France to raise awareness among young community leaders on the importance of SDGs’ activism and partnerships on all levels.
Sameh helped establish the first youth engagement mechanism at an Arab Intergovernmental Organization in 2018 and now serves as the Organising Partner for External Affairs and International Relations at the Arab Youth Platform for Sustainable Development – League of Arab States.
